Hotel Wi-Fi: what it logs, what it cannot see, and what to do first
The most hostile network you will join all year, explained honestly: captive portals, forged DNS, the 90-second window — and the check-in routine.
The short version. Hotel, airport and campus gateways see your DNS, your SNI hostnames and your metadata — and some monetize the login itself with ads and retargeting. Real 2026 campaigns hijacked hotel gateways to redirect even Microsoft logins. The defense is a routine, not an app: verify the network name, survive the captive portal with minimal exposure, connect the VPN immediately, and only then open anything sensitive.
What the gateway sees
A hotel gateway sits where your home router sits, except it is run by strangers with commercial incentives. Without a VPN it sees the full table from our companion post: DNS lookups in the clear, SNI hostnames of every TLS connection, metadata (addresses, sizes, timing), and anything still on plain HTTP. Some properties log per-room and per-device; all of them can, because the equipment ships with the feature.
The portal is a business, not just a login
That “enter your email for free Wi-Fi” page is programmatic advertising infrastructure: sponsored videos, email capture, post-stay retargeting. Your address joins a marketing database the moment you trade it for bandwidth. Worse, portals run over plain HTTP with DNS the gateway controls — which is why forged answers and redirect campaigns keep working there year after year, including credential harvesting aimed at cloud logins. The portal page deserves exactly as much trust as a billboard: read what it asks, give the minimum.
The 90-second window
No VPN can be up before you join the network, so the captive-portal dance — join, get redirected, log in, wait for clearance — happens in the clear by construction. Sixty to ninety seconds where DNS answers may be forged, redirects may point anywhere, and every lookup is visible. This window is where the real 2026 hotel-gateway attacks lived: not by breaking encryption, but by striking before any tunnel existed. Naming it is the defense: nothing sensitive happens inside those ninety seconds. No banking, no webmail, no cloud logins beyond the portal itself — and the portal credentials should be throwaway (room number plus a password you would print on a poster).
Chargers, USB ports and the business-center PC
Two travel myths to retire. First, public USB charging ports: modern phones negotiate power without exposing data by default — and have for years — so “juice jacking” through a lobby port is mostly a ghost story from 2019. A cheap data-blocking cable ends the debate either way. Second, the business-center PC: assume it is compromised (keyloggers, missing updates, previous guests' malware) and never log into anything personal there. A VPN cannot clean a dirty endpoint, and no checkout routine fixes typing your password into someone else's keylogger.
The check-in routine
- Confirm the exact network name at reception — rogue access points with plausible names are the oldest trick in the book.
- Join from your phone first if you can, keeping the laptop offline until the path is proven.
- Clear the portal with minimum data, watching certificates: a portal asking for a banking password is not a portal.
- Connect the VPN immediately — full tunnel, DNS inside it — and verify with a leak check before opening anything else.
- Keep the kill switch on for the whole stay: hotel networks drop constantly, and every reconnect without a tunnel repeats the exposure.
- Prefer mobile data for the two minutes of actual banking, even with everything above. Defense in depth is not paranoia on hostile networks; it is the baseline.
